What is 20 Cogs?

Firstly, 20 Cogs is definitely not a scam.  It has a 4-star rating on Trustpilot and most people have a positive experience with earning money easily.

20 Cogs is an on-line website that basically pays you to sign up to various offers.  These can include competitions, surveys, offers and gaming.  Some of the companies look more familiar than others with Amazon’s name being one of them. The amount you earn is usually somewhere between £2.00-£30 for each offer you complete.  This means that your earnings for completing all the offers is usually around £100-£200, although I have seen earnings of up to £300.  Sounds easy right?

Don’t get too excited though, you can’t collect your cash until you’ve completed all 20 offers.  This is where some people lose out so if you decide to give it go, make sure you complete all of your cogs otherwise you won’t get paid.

How Does 20 Cogs work?

To get started, you need to set up an account with 20 Cogs. This is absolutely FREE and you can sign up here to get started.

On your screen you’ll see 20 grey cogs. Each cog is a different offer. Just click on the first cog and it will take you to your first offer. You can click on the offer and complete it or go to an ‘alternative offer’.  Once you’ve completed an offer, your cog will turn amber so you can see at a glance how many cogs you’ve completed. This can take up to 24 hours so if you’ve completed a task and it’s still grey, don’t worry just give it time. Then, when it turns green it means it’s been approved by the advertiser which usually takes a few days.

You can choose to do all 20 cogs at once then just wait for approval or do them in your free time over a period of time.  Just fit it in when suits you!

Some Top Tips Before Making Money on 20 Cogs

  • If you decide to sign up and give this a go, I recommend you set up a separate email address.  That way if you get any spam emails after completing the offer, it’s not going to clog up your emails.
  • Use a PAYG Sim or a fake phone number to fill in the offers so you don’t get companies calling you after you’ve completed the offers.
  • Make sure you read the terms of the offers and that you are happy to proceed before completing.  If you are not happy with the offer, move onto the next one.  You will get a choice of two or more offers per cog so you can choose the one that suits you best.
  • Look out for reputable companies with high payments.  There are some really good offers on there from companies you will recognise immediately.  Some of these are where you can really build up your income.
  • Keep a record of any subscriptions you sign up to and the renewal dates so you can cancel accordingly.  A spreadsheet or a simple note in a diary is all you need to ensure you keep on top of them after the free trial period is over.
  • Make sure you complete all 20 cogs (even if it takes you a few weeks just completing the odd one in your spare time) otherwise you won’t get paid!
  • Take a screenshot of your completed cogs.  20 cogs customer service is really good so if you have any issues you can send them a screenshot of what you’ve done.
  • Don’t give up!  If you get so far and can’t find a suitable offer.  Take a break from it and see if the offers change.
